Title:
RECOMBINANT DNA OBTAINED BY INCORPORATING DNA CODING FOR MYOSIN HEAVY CHAIN SM1 ISOFORM PROTEIN INTO VECTOR DNA, MICROORGANISM INCLUDING THE RECOMBINANT DNA AND THERAPEUTIC AGENT FOR ARTERIOSCLEROSIS

Abstract:

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To obtain the subject new DNA obtained by incorporating a specific DNA coding for a smooth muscle-type myosin heavy chain SM1 isoform protein into a vector and useful for a therapeutic agent for gene therapy for restenosis after PTCA treatment and a therapeutic agent for arteriosclerosis, or the like.
SOLUTION: This new recombinant DNA is obtained by incorporating a DNA, which codes for a smooth muscle-type myosin heavy chain SM1 isoform protein and consists of the base sequence of the formula, or a DNA, in which one or several bases are added, deleted or substituted in the base sequence, into a DNA of a vector and is useful for a therapeutic agent for a gene therapy for restenosis after treatment of percutaneous transluminal coronary angioplasty(PTCA) in which a stenosed part is widened using a balloon catheter and a therapeutic agent for arteriosclerosis, or the like, for the treatment of arteriosclerosis. The recombinant DNA is obtained by cloning a cDNA library of mouse uterus using a cDNA of a rabbit smooth muscle-type myosin heavy chain SM2 isoform protein as a probe and incorporating the resultant gene into a vector.
